However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.
As always, when you get stuck, checking out a tech-tips database may quickly identify your problem and solution.In that case, you can greatly simplify your troubleshooting or at least confirm a diagnosis before ordering parts.

REPAIRING / SERVICING TV PANASONIC TX-LR32E6

Technical description and composition of the PANASONIC TX-LR32E6 TV, panel type and modules used. The composition of the modules.
PANASONIC LED
Model: TX-LR32E6
Chassis / Version: LA41
Panel: LC320EUN (FF) (M1)
LED backlight: 6922L-0054A 32 V13 ART3 Edge REV0.2 1 6920L-0001C
T-CON: 6870C-0438A
LED driver (backlight): 6971L-0144A KLS-E320SNAHF06 A
PWM LED driver: BD9470EFV
MOSFET LED driver: FDD850N10L
Power Supply (PSU): TNPA5852 2P
PWM Power: BM1P102FJ-E2
MainBoard: TNPH1041 1 A
IC MainBoard: MT5590CAHJ, K4B2G1646E-BQKO, H27U4G8F2DTR, AN34043A
Tuner: TDSA-G220D
Control: IR: TNPA5785

General recommendations for TV LCD LED repair
Possible manifestations of defects
- PANASONIC TX-LR32E6 does not turn on and does not show any signs of operability at all. Does not blink indicators and does not respond to control buttons.
Usually, with such manifestations, the defect is caused by faulty elements in the main TNPA5852 power supply module. Its output voltages should be measured and, in their absence, the serviceability of the power switches and rectifier diodes in the converters should be checked for possible breakdown.
In case of breakdowns in the secondary circuits, the converter can operate in short-circuit mode, and in case of short-circuit in the elements of the primary circuit, the mains fuse usually breaks off.
Breakdown of Mos-Fet switches used in switching power supplies is often caused by malfunctions of other elements, for example, in the power supply circuit of the PWM regulator, in frequency setting or damper circuits, as well as in negative feedback stabilization. PWM microcircuits (PWM) BM1P102FJ-E2 are usually checked by replacing them with new ones, or known to be working properly.
- There is no picture, but there is sound and reaction to the remote control. Or, for a second, the image may appear immediately after switching on.
In some of these cases, the malfunction is caused by the lack of display backlighting. The reason for this may be an open circuit in the LED circuit, or a problem in stabilizing their power supply.
When diagnosing, it must be borne in mind that it is impossible to check for an open in the circuit of the LED lines without disassembling the panels using a tester or multimeter. To open all PN junctions connected in series, a voltage of the order of several tens of volts is required, and ideally a current source. Opening the panel, you can check each LED separately. Typically, Chinese multimeters will lightly light one 3-volt LED when the probes are connected to it in the forward direction. For dual 6-volt LEDs, the PN junction of its emergency zener diode can serve as an indicator of the LED health. In the event of a malfunction of the LED, its zener diode will either be cut off or pierced in the K / Z.
- The TV does not go into operation, does not respond to the remote control. The indicator on the front panel is on or blinking.
Repair or diagnostics of the TNPH1041 motherboard should begin with checking the stabilizers and power converters required to power the microcircuits and matrix. If necessary, you should update or replace the software (software). Sometimes it is necessary to check or replace (if necessary) the elements of the MainBoard - MT5590CAHJ, K4B2G1646E-BQKO, H27U4G8F2DTR, AN34043A. In cases where a BGA processor is used, its malfunction is usually detected by a local warm-up method.
Before changing the TDSA-G220D tuner, if it is not possible to tune to TV channels, you should make sure that there are supply voltages, which must be measured at the corresponding tuner terminals and check the software for correctness. The pulses of data exchange between the tuner and the processor can be monitored with an oscilloscope

 If the PANASONIC TX-LR32E6 has no picture, but there is sound, often the LCD backlight LC320EUN (FF) (M1) simply does not work. Moreover, in LED TVs, the LEDs inside the panel usually fail, less often the LED driver.
In such cases, you can see a barely noticeable image with a successful hit of external light on the screen.
Replacing the LEDs requires disassembling the LC320EUN LCD panel, a process that requires experience and qualifications from the technician. We do not recommend doing such work on your own to the owners of TVs and craftsmen who do not have experience in repairing LCD panels

If there is no image, and the backlight is on, the screen becomes slightly lighter when turned on, and in an open TV you can see light through the holes in the panel case.
In this case, the panel may also be faulty - damage to strips, loops, for example, as a result of moisture ingress after unsuccessful washing of the screen, the T-CON (Timing Controller) board may be faulty. But often the main board MainBoard TNPH1041 also turns out to be faulty, a software failure is also possible.
Then, first of all, you need to check the panel supply voltage, the fuses on the T-CON board, as well as the supply and reference voltages of the column and line drivers - VGH, VGL, Vcom.
If these measurements are within the normal range, it is necessary to trace the passage of LVDS signals from the MainBoard TNPH1041 with an oscilloscope, as well as synchronization signals to the loops with drivers.
Flooded or unsuccessfully washed screens of LED TVs can be restored, in about half of the cases, usually if significant damage has not formed in the loops and panel strips.

 To reduce the backlight current in LED drivers with a BD9470EFV controller (TSSOP-B28), you should proportionally increase the total resistance of the resistors from pin 8 (ISET) to the case. Resistance Rset (in kilo-ohms) is selected from the ratio 3000 / Iled, where Iled is the maximum current in each of the six channels in milliamperes.

The main features of the PANASONIC TX-LR32E6 device:
Installed matrix (LED panel) LC320EUN (FF) (M1).
Matrix control uses the Timing Controller (T-CON) 6870C-0438A.
The LED driver 6971L-0144A is used to power the backlight LEDs, it is controlled by the PWM controller BD9470EFV. The keys of the FDD850N10L type are used as power elements of the LED driver.
The formation of the necessary supply voltages for all nodes of the PANASONIC TX-LR32E6 TV is carried out by the TNPA5852 power module, or its analogs using BM1P102FJ-E2 microcircuits.
MainBoard - the main board (motherboard) is a TNPH1041 module using MT5590CAHJ, K4B2G1646E-BQKO, H27U4G8F2DTR, AN34043A and others.
The TDSA-G220D tuner provides reception of television programs and tuning to channels.

TV PANASONIC TX-LR32E6 with LCD LC320EUN, diagonal size 32 "(81 cm) 16: 9 format. The technology of production of the screen of this TV model is realized with LED backlighting.
The LC320EUN panel and TNPH1041 motherboard firmware provide HD and Full HD viewing at 1920x1080 pixels in 1080p (Full HD) graphics.
The TX-LR32E6 TV is equipped with SMART software, built-in applications and the ability to work on the Internet. Internet connection can be made via Wi-Fi wireless connection. The input analog video signal can be processed in PAL, SECAM, NTSC systems. Graphic processing and formation of a digital signal picture occurs in the standards 480i, 480p, 576i, 576p, 720p, 1080i, 1080p. Multimedia file formats supported by the video processor: MP3, WMA, MPEG4, MKV, JPEG.
The power of the acoustic audio system is 20 W (2x10 W) provided by two speakers. Uses NICAM stereo signal system and Sound Surround function.
An external interface (communication with other devices) is supported by standard input and output connectors: antenna input (RF), AV, component, SCART, RGB, HDMI x3, USB x2, Ethernet (RJ-45), Wi-Fi. A headphone output is provided for individual listening. To connect a computer or laptop, a VGA (D-Sub 15) connector is used, supporting resolutions: 1920x1080.
The digital tuner is capable of receiving terrestrial and cable channels in the DVB-T MPEG4, DVB-C, DVB-T2 standards.
The power consumed by the TV in operating mode from the network is 80 watts.
Dimensions: with stand 724x489x207 mm, without stand 724x434x53 mm.
TV weight: with stand: 9.5 kg, without stand: 8.5 kg.
